Stubby was a famous war dog. He was a stray mutt who was adopted by soldiers during World War I. Stubby became a mascot for the troops. He alerted the soldiers to gas attacks and even once caught a German spy by the seat of his pants. His bravery made him a hero and he was highly decorated for his services.

Sgt Stubby had several heroic deeds. He was very good at detecting mustard gas attacks. His quick reactions saved many soldiers from harm. Moreover, he showed great courage by going into dangerous areas to look for wounded comrades. His presence on the front lines also provided moral support to the soldiers. He was like a little guardian angel for the troops.
